+#ifdef INTGEMM_COMPILER_SUPPORTS_AVX512
+// gcc 5.4.0 bizarrely supports avx512bw targets but not __builtin_cpu_supports("avx512bw"). So implement it manually.
+inline bool CheckAVX512BW() {
+#ifdef __INTEL_COMPILER
+ return _may_i_use_cpu_feature(_FEATURE_AVX512BW)
+#elif __GNUC__
+ unsigned int m = __get_cpuid_max(0, NULL);
+ if (m < 7) return false;
+ unsigned int eax, ebx, ecx, edx;
+ __cpuid_count(7, 0, eax, ebx, ecx, edx);
+ const unsigned int avx512bw_bit = (1 << 30);
+ return ebx & avx512bw_bit;
+#else
+ return __builtin_cpu_supports("avx512bw");
+#endif
+}
+#endif
